Crafting Your Resume
- Choose the Correct Format Start by choosing the most appropriate cover letter format. For those who are starting their careers or switching fields or industries, a functional resume may be a good choice. It is focused on skills and abilities rather than chronological work experience. However, if you have relevant experience in the disability support field, consider using a reverse-chronological resume format.
- Contact Information Contact Information: Start your resume with your contact information that is accurate in the upper right corner of the document. Include your full name, professional email address as well as your phone number. LinkedIn profile (if applicable), and location Griffith .
- Summary Statement: Create an engaging summary that highlights your experiences as a disability support worker and highlights your primary qualifications. Ensure it is concise and effective.
- Skills Section Include relevant capabilities such as communication compassion, empathy ability to solve problems, and any other certifications or credentials related to disability-related work.
- Work Experience: Detail your previous positions in reverse-chronological order (listing the most recent first). Explain each job with action verbs while highlighting specific duties and achievements that relate to supporting individuals with disabilities.
- Education include the details of your current education including any certificates or degrees you’ve earned.
- volunteer experience If you’ve worked for disability support organizations or related charities, showcase this experience. It demonstrates your commitment to make a difference, and will distinguish you from the other applicants.
